Tag: android fragments

La navigation vers le haut (la flèche arrière de la barre d'action) ne fonctionne pas pour les fragments

J'ai une disposition de tiroir comme disposition de base de mon activité et je remplace deux fragments sur un cadre présent à l'intérieur de cette disposition de tiroir. Le premier fragment n'est pas ajouté dans la pile arrière du fragment. Je montre l'icône de l'hamburger dans mon activité (je veux aussi le menu du tiroir […]

La meilleure pratique pour la navigation par onglets?

Je cherche la meilleure pratique d'utilisation de la navigation par onglets avec la barre d'action Sherlock. Quelle est la bonne façon de changer les fragments, et d'ajouter des fragments à la couche arrière et de supprimer la pile arrière lorsqu'un autre onglet est sélectionné. Y a-t-il de bons exemples ou des projets open source montrant […]

NavigationDrawer fragment avec ListView et en-tête personnalisé

J'ai un problème et je ne peux pas le résoudre. Dans mon application, j'ai un tiroir de navigation défini comme suit: Activity_main.xml <android.support.v4.widget.DrawerL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:tools="http://schemas.android.com/tools" android:id="@+id/drawer_layout" android:layout_width="match_parent" android:layout_height="match_parent" > <!– As the main content view, the view below consumes the entire space available using match_parent in both dimensions. –> <FrameLayout android:id="@+id/container" android:layout_width="match_parent" android:layout_height="match_parent" /> <!– […]

AndroidRuntimeException: requestFeature () doit être appelé avant d'ajouter du contenu

J'ai un fragment de dialogue. J'ai l'intention d'utiliser ce fragment dans l'activité et le dialogue. Et j'autorise la méthode onCreateDialog et onCreateView. Voici le codage. @Override public View onCreateView(LayoutInflater inflater, ViewGroup container, Bundle savedInstanceState) { View view = inflater.inflate(R.layout.interval_time_popup, null); setup(view, false); return view; } @Override public Dialog onCreateDialog(Bundle savedInstanceState) { AlertDialog.Builder builder = new […]

La fonction OnActivityCreated () de Fragment s'appelle après onDestroy () of Activity

Aujourd'hui, j'ai remarqué un comportement étrange dans ma demande. Cela arrive quand j'arrête mon application en utilisant la vue Périphériques depuis Eclipse. Quelqu'un peut-il l'expliquer? Pourquoi onActivityCreated() of Fragment s'appelle même lorsque l' Activity est déjà détruite? MyHomeActivity contient deux Fragment s et un journal similaire est généré pour les deux. Ici, je collage des […]

Android ScrollView ne peut héberger qu'un enfant direct

J'ai un auditeur onclick de la galerie qui devrait effacer toutes les lignes dans la tableview, puis ajouter des lignes / des lignes à une tableview à l'intérieur d'une vue de défilement. Le fragment doit changer à chaque clic de bouton. Cependant, je reçois: java.lang.IllegalStateException: ScrollView peut héberger un seul enfant direct. Écouteur de bouton […]

Fragment Entrée récursive pour exécuterPendingTransactions Error

J'ai une erreur comme suit: 03-01 11:20:43.453: E/AndroidRuntime(31235): java.lang.RuntimeException: Error receiving broadcast Intent { act=com.qz.Blaze.ServiceStarted flg=0x10 } in com.qz.Blaze.$ServiceStartedReceiver@423540f0 03-01 11:20:43.453: E/AndroidRuntime(31235): at android.app.LoadedApk$ReceiverDispatcher$Args.run(LoadedApk.java:766) 03-01 11:20:43.453: E/AndroidRuntime(31235): at android.os.Handler.handleCallback(Handler.java:615) 03-01 11:20:43.453: E/AndroidRuntime(31235): at android.os.Handler.dispatchMessage(Handler.java:92) 03-01 11:20:43.453: E/AndroidRuntime(31235): at android.os.Looper.loop(Looper.java:137) 03-01 11:20:43.453: E/AndroidRuntime(31235): at android.app.ActivityThread.main(ActivityThread.java:4921) 03-01 11:20:43.453: E/AndroidRuntime(31235): at java.lang.reflect.Method.invokeNative(Native Method) 03-01 11:20:43.453: E/AndroidRuntime(31235): at java.lang.reflect.Method.invoke(Method.java:511) […]

Essayez d'invoquer la méthode virtuelle 'void android.support.v4.view.ViewPager.setAdapter (android.support.v4.view.PagerAdapter)' sur une référence d'objet nulle

J'essaie d'implémenter la disposition des onglets glissants en utilisant la conception de matériel Android. Mais cela me donne NullPointerException . Voici mon code jusqu'à présent: MainActivity.java public class MainActivity extends ActionBarActivity { private Toolbar toolbar; private ViewPager pager; private SlidingTabLayout nLayout; @Override protected void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); setContentView(R.layout.activity_main_appbar); toolbar = (Toolbar) findViewById(R.id.app_bar); setSupportActionBar(toolbar); getSupportActionBar().setDisplayShowHomeEnabled(true); […]

Fermer le tiroir de navigation lors du démarrage de l'application

J'ai développé une application avec le tiroir de navigation. Chaque fois que l'application commence pour la première fois, elle a ouvert le tiroir de navigation. Y a-t-il un moyen de la mettre en état? Ci-dessous le code généré automatiquement pour votre compréhension. import com.example.navigationdrawer.R; import android.support.v7.app.ActionBarActivity; import android.app.Activity; import android.support.v7.app.ActionBar; import android.support.v4.app.Fragment; import android.support.v4.app.ActionBarDrawerToggle; import […]

ViewFlipper vs Fragments

J'ai une activité avec un ViewFlipper qui flambe entre un tas de vues (pages) avec mes données. Je envisage d'utiliser l'API fragments pour passer de mes vues. Quels sont les avantages de le faire? Puis-je voir un gain de performance en utilisant des fragments puisque le ViewFlipper bascule essentiellement les drapeaux de visibilité et les […]

coAndroid est un fan Android de Google, tout sur les téléphones Android, Android Wear, Android Dev et Android Games Apps.